                                                               CHARLES SOBHRAJ:

Born as Hotchand Bhawnani Gurmukh Sobhraj on April 6, 1944, in Saigon (now Ho Chi Minh City, Vietnam), Charles Sobhraj is a name that evokes intrigue, fear, and fascination. His life story reads like a gripping thriller—one that spans continents, eludes authorities, and leaves a trail of mystery and tragedy.

The Early Years:

  • Sobhraj’s birthplace, a French colonial territory, made him eligible for French citizenship.
  • Raised by his mother and her new husband, a French Army lieutenant stationed in” French Indochina“, Sobhraj moved between Southeast Asia and France.
  • His teenage years saw the emergence of a criminal streak, with petty crimes leading to his first custodial sentence for burglary in 1963.

 

The Infamous Moniker: “The Serpent”

  • Sobhraj’s criminal career escalated dramatically during the 1970s.
  • He preyed on Western tourists traveling the hippie trail of South Asia.
  • Nicknamed “The Serpent” for his snake-like ability to avoid detection, he allegedly murdered at least 20 tourists across South and Southeast Asia, including 14 in Thailand.

The Convictions and Imprisonment

  • In 1976, Sobhraj was convicted and jailed in India.
  • After his release, he returned to France.
  • In 2003, he went to Nepal, where he was arrested, tried, and given a life sentence.

The Recent Twist

  • On December 21, 2022, the Supreme Court of Nepal ordered his release due to his old age, after serving 19 years of his prison term.
  • On December 23, he was released and deported to France
